Sapphire Pulse Radeon RX 5700 XT 8G: boasts a maximum frequency of 1.670 GHz+ 4 % GHz + 6%. It is equipped with 8 GBGB of RAM. The memory type is GDDR6. It was released in Q3/2019.

ASUS ROG Strix Radeon RX 580 OC: It has a maximum clock speed of 1.257 GHz GHz. It comes with 8 GBGB of memory. The memory type is GDDR5. Released in Q1 Q4/2017.

FP32 Performance (Single-precision TFLOPS)
Benchmark FP32 to 32-bitowe obliczenia zmiennoprzecinkowe dla GPU, które są wymagane w grach 3D.
9.86
Sapphire Pulse Radeon RX 5700 XT 8G
6.36
ASUS ROG Strix Radeon RX 580 OC
Battlefield 5
Battlefield 5 to realistyczna gra, z wbudowanym benchmarkiem, bardzo dobrze nadająca się jako test dla kart graficznych.
58 fps (avg)
Sapphire Pulse Radeon RX 5700 XT 8G
37 fps (avg)
ASUS ROG Strix Radeon RX 580 OC
Shadow of the Tomb Raider
Shadow of the Tomb Raider posiada wbudowany benchmark, oparty na silniku Crystal Dynamics Foundation.
37 fps (avg)
Sapphire Pulse Radeon RX 5700 XT 8G
23 fps (avg)
ASUS ROG Strix Radeon RX 580 OC
